  • Page 8: Introduction

    Introduction Leica DFC Cameras are controlled by Leica DFC Twain camera software. Leica DFC Twain supports image acquisition under Leica LAS, Leica IM and Leica QWin and image editors such as Imaging ®, Photoshop ® and Paint Shop Pro ®.

  • Page 23: Selecting The Active Camera

    Selecting the Active Camera You can connect as many Leica DFC cameras at the same time as there are FireWire ports in the computer. (Be aware that performance may suffer if you have multiple FireWire peripherals.) Leica DFC cameras are “Plug and Play” FireWire devices.

  • Page 26 Each configuration is valid for any camera of the same model. This means that you can create a configuration with one Leica DFC280 and load it using another Leica DFC280. However, you cannot load a configuration created on a Leica DFC280 for use with a Leica DFC300FX, for example.

  • Page 30: Shading Correction

    To create a perfectly corrected, homogeneous image, a white image, ie an image of the exposure light only and no subject, is taken as reference and calculated into the live and captured image. Without shading correction With shading correction Leica DFC Cameras – Image Acquisition Guide...

  • Page 34: Color Depth

    The visible quality depends on factors such as the image editor software, your monitor and size displayed. DFC Twain and Leica DFC cameras can acquire images in 8 bits or 16 bits. However, only HQ resolution modes allow image acquisition in 16 bits.

  • Page 59: Chip Size

    Please note that this is for reference only – DFC Twain does not use this information itself. However, for applications such as Leica IM, the size of the sensor is required to calculate the calibration of the image in conjunction with the microscope optics data.
